repo.or.cz
/
official-gcc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
[8/77] Simplify gen_trunc/extend_conv_libfunc
2017-08-30
rsand
i
f
o
[8/77]
S
implify g
e
n_tr
u
nc/extend_conv_libfunc
commit
|
commitdiff
|
tree
2017-08-30
rsandifo
[7/77] Add
s
calar_float_mode
commit
|
commitdiff
|
tree
2017-08-30
rs
a
ndifo
[6/77]
M
a
k
e G
E
T_MOD
E
_W
I
DER
return an
o
pt_mode
commit
|
commitdiff
|
tree
2017-08-30
rsandifo
[5/77]
S
ma
l
l tweak to array_value_type
commit
|
commitdiff
|
tree
2017-08-30
rsandifo
[4/77] Add FOR_EACH itera
t
ors for modes
commit
|
commitdiff
|
tree
2017-08-30
r
s
a
nd
i
fo
[3/7
7
] Allo
w
machin
e
modes to be classes
commit
|
commitdiff
|
tree
2017-08-30
rsandi
f
o
[2/77] Add an
E_ pr
e
fix to
case stateme
n
t
s
commit
|
commitdiff
|
tree
2017-08-30
rs
a
ndif
o
[1/
7
7] Add an E_ prefix to mode nam
e
s
commit
|
commitdiff
|
tree
2017-08-30
rsandifo
Split out par
t
s of sco
m
pare
_
loc_descriptor and emit_store_fl
a
g
commit
|
commitdiff
|
tree
2017-08-30
rsandi
f
o
[rs
6
000] in
t
->machine
_
mode in
rs60
0
0-c
.
c
commit
|
commitdiff
|
tree
2017-08-29
rsandifo
Set th
e
c
a
ll nothro
w
fla
g
more of
t
en
commit
|
commitdiff
|
tree
2017-08-24
rsa
n
difo
Make more u
s
e of subreg_offset_from_lsb
commit
|
commitdiff
|
tree
2017-08-22
r
sandifo
Make more use of paradoxica
l
_subreg_
p
commit
|
commitdiff
|
tree
2017-08-22
rs
a
ndifo
[AArch6
4
] Fix label mo
d
e
commit
|
commitdiff
|
tree
2017-08-21
r
s
andifo
Si
m
pli
f
y p
a
d_belo
w
implement
a
tion
commit
|
commitdiff
|
tree
2017-08-21
rsandifo
R
e
mo
v
e t
h
e frame
size argum
e
nt fro
m
function_p
r
olo
g
ue
.
.
.
commit
|
commitdiff
|
tree
2017-08-21
rsandifo
Add a
t
ype_
h
as_mode_precision_p helper
f
u
n
c
t
ion
commit
|
commitdiff
|
tree
2017-08-21
rsandifo
Move vector_type_mode to
t
r
ee
.
c
commit
|
commitdiff
|
tree
2017-08-21
rsandifo
Pas
s
rtx and
i
ndex
t
o read-md
.
c iterator routin
e
s
commit
|
commitdiff
|
tree
2017-08-21
rsand
i
fo
Fix bogus CO
N
ST_WIDE_INT ha
s
h
commit
|
commitdiff
|
tree
2017-08-17
rsandifo
Add
m
issin
g
E
C
F_NOT
H
ROW flags to
internal
.
def
commit
|
commitdiff
|
tree
2017-08-16
rsan
d
ifo
PR81815: Invali
d
c
ondi
t
i
o
nal redu
c
t
i
o
n
commit
|
commitdiff
|
tree
2017-08-10
rsandi
f
o
PR81738: Split vect-a
l
i
a
s-check-6
.
c
commit
|
commitdiff
|
tree
2017-08-04
rsandifo
Pool
a
l
ignm
e
nt inf
o
rm
a
tion for common bases
commit
|
commitdiff
|
tree
2017-08-04
rsan
d
ifo
C++-ify vec_info s
t
ruct
u
res
commit
|
commitdiff
|
tree
2017-08-04
rsandifo
U
se base inequ
a
lity for some vector
a
l
ia
s
chec
k
s
commit
|
commitdiff
|
tree
2017-08-04
rsandifo
H
andle
d
ata depend
e
nce relations with di
f
ferent b
a
se
s
commit
|
commitdiff
|
tree
2017-07-27
rsandifo
[rs6
0
0
0] Avoid rot
a
tes
of floating-point mode
s
commit
|
commitdiff
|
tree
2017-07-08
rsa
n
d
i
fo
Fi
x
c
o
retypes
.
h-r
e
l
ate
d
depende
n
cies
commit
|
commitdiff
|
tree
2017-07-08
rsandifo
Force a depend
e
nc
e
dista
n
ce of 1 in gnat
.
dg/vect17
.
ad
b
commit
|
commitdiff
|
tree
2017-07-05
rsandifo
U
s
e SET_DECL_
M
ODE in libcc1
commit
|
commitdiff
|
tree
2017-07-05
rsandifo
Remove enum
before
machi
n
e_mode
commit
|
commitdiff
|
tree
2017-07-04
rsand
i
fo
PR 81
2
92: ICE on related strl
e
ns aft
e
r r249880
commit
|
commitdiff
|
tree
2017-07-03
rsandifo
Avoi
d
m
i
nimu
m
- 1 confusion in vect
o
riser
commit
|
commitdiff
|
tree
2017-07-03
r
sandifo
Ad
d
a helper for ge
t
ting the
o
verall
a
lignment of
a
DR
commit
|
commitdiff
|
tree
2017-07-03
rsan
d
i
f
o
A
d
d D
R
_BASE_ALIGNMENT and DR_BASE_MISALIGN
M
ENT
commit
|
commitdiff
|
tree
2017-07-03
rs
a
ndi
f
o
A
dd DR_STE
P
_A
L
I
GNM
E
NT
commit
|
commitdiff
|
tree
2017-07-03
rsandifo
Rename DR
_
A
L
I
G
N
ED_
T
O
to
DR_OFFSET_A
L
IGNMENT
commit
|
commitdiff
|
tree
2017-07-03
rsandifo
Make dr_ana
l
yze_innerm
o
st operate
on in
n
ermost_loop_
b
ehavior
commit
|
commitdiff
|
tree
2017-07-03
rsand
i
fo
Use
innermost_loop_
b
ehavior f
o
r outer loop vect
o
ris
a
tion
commit
|
commitdiff
|
tree
2017-07-03
rsandifo
T
wea
k
BB ana
l
ysis for dr_analyze_inner
m
ost
commit
|
commitdiff
|
tree
2017-07-02
rsandifo
Reo
r
g
anise machmode
.
h headers
commit
|
commitdiff
|
tree
2017-07-02
rsa
n
difo
Make
tree-ssa-strlen
.
c hand
l
e
part
i
al u
n
t
ermi
n
ated
.
.
.
commit
|
commitdiff
|
tree
2017-07-02
rsandifo
P
R
8
0769: In
c
orrect
s
tr
l
en
optimisation
commit
|
commitdiff
|
tree
2017-07-02
rsandifo
P
R8
1
136:
I
C
E
f
r
o
m incons
i
s
t
ent DR_MISALIGNM
E
NTs
commit
|
commitdiff
|
tree
2017-06-12
rsandifo
Fix pessimistic D
I
mode handling i
n
c
o
mbin
e
.
c
:ma
k
e_field_as
s
i
.
.
.
commit
|
commitdiff
|
tree
2017-06-07
rsandifo
Clarify defi
n
e_insn doc
u
me
n
tation
commit
|
commitdiff
|
tree
2017-05-31
rsandifo
[
1
/2] Add get_next_
s
tr
i
nfo helper func
t
i
on
commit
|
commitdiff
|
tree
2017-05-31
rsandifo
Alt
e
rn
a
tive c
h
eck f
o
r
vector ref
s
wit
h
same alignment
commit
|
commitdiff
|
tree
2017-05-08
r
sandi
f
o
[AArch
6
4] Tighten move constraints for symb
o
l
i
c operands
commit
|
commitdiff
|
tree
2017-05-06
rsa
n
d
i
fo
Rec
o
rd equiva
l
ence
s
for spill registers
commit
|
commitdiff
|
tree
2017-05-06
rsa
n
dif
o
P
R
7
5
964: Invalid integer ABS han
d
lin
g
i
n simplify
.
.
.
commit
|
commitdiff
|
tree
2017-05-04
r
s
andifo
Cap nite
r
_for_u
n
r
olled_loop to upper
b
ound
commit
|
commitdiff
|
tree
2017-05-04
rsandifo
F
i
x
p
revio
u
s commit
commit
|
commitdiff
|
tree
2017-05-04
rsandif
o
Remove bogu
s
top-l
e
vel Chang
e
Log co
m
mit
(
sorry!)
commit
|
commitdiff
|
tree
2017-05-03
rsandi
f
o
Wrap tree-data-ref
.
h macro argume
n
ts
commit
|
commitdiff
|
tree
2017-03-10
r
sandi
f
o
[libstdc++-v3] Fix detection of obs
o
lete
isnan
commit
|
commitdiff
|
tree
2017-01-13
rsandifo
A
v
oid ex
c
essively-big hash tables in empty-add cycle
s
commit
|
commitdiff
|
tree
2017-01-13
rsandifo
Shor
t
-circuit
a
lt_fail case in record
_
r
eg_classes
commit
|
commitdiff
|
tree
2016-12-24
rsandifo
Make it cheape
r
t
o test whether an SSA name is a virtu
a
l
.
.
.
commit
|
commitdiff
|
tree
2016-11-25
rsandifo
Tweak LRA
h
andlin
g
o
f shared spill slo
t
s
commit
|
commitdiff
|
tree
2016-11-25
rsan
d
ifo
Set
m
ode of d
e
c
im
a
l f
l
oats before cal
l
ing layou
t
_type
commit
|
commitdiff
|
tree
2016-11-25
rsandifo
Add run tests for recent sibcall
p
atches
commit
|
commitdiff
|
tree
2016-11-25
rsandifo
T
i
ghten
c
h
e
ck
for
whether sibcall referenc
e
s lo
c
al
.
.
.
commit
|
commitdiff
|
tree
2016-11-23
rsandifo
Rework subreg_get_info
commit
|
commitdiff
|
tree
2016-11-23
rsandifo
Add more subreg offset helpers
commit
|
commitdiff
|
tree
2016-11-21
rsandif
o
Ha
n
dl
e
sibcalls wi
t
h aggregat
e
r
e
turns
commit
|
commitdiff
|
tree
2016-11-18
rsandifo
Make load
_
extend_op
a
n inline fu
n
cti
o
n
commit
|
commitdiff
|
tree
2016-11-18
rsandifo
U
s
e rtx_mode_
t
in
s
tead of std
:
:make_pair
commit
|
commitdiff
|
tree
2016-11-18
r
sandifo
Add
S
ET_DECL_MO
D
E
commit
|
commitdiff
|
tree
2016-11-16
rsandifo
Fix nb_iterations calculation in tree-v
e
ct-loop-m
a
nip
.
c
commit
|
commitdiff
|
tree
2016-11-16
rsandi
f
o
An alternative fix for PR70944
commit
|
commitdiff
|
tree
2016-11-16
rsandifo
Fix vec_cmp
co
m
parison mode
commit
|
commitdiff
|
tree
2016-11-16
rsandi
f
o
Use df_
r
ead_modify_
s
ubre
g
_p in c
p
r
o
p
.
c
commit
|
commitdiff
|
tree
2016-11-16
rsandifo
Optimi
s
e CONCAT
handl
i
ng
i
n emit_group
_
load
commit
|
commitdiff
|
tree
2016-11-16
rsandifo
Fix han
d
ling of
u
n
known size
s
i
n rtx
_
a
d
dr
_
can_trap_p
commit
|
commitdiff
|
tree
2016-11-16
rs
a
ndifo
Fix nb_iteration
s
_estimate
calcu
l
ation in t
r
ee-vect
.
.
.
commit
|
commitdiff
|
tree
2016-11-16
rsandifo
F
i
x pdp11 build
commit
|
commitdiff
|
tree
2016-11-16
rsandif
o
Fix
mi
s
sing
b
rac
k
ets
in a
r
c
.
c
commit
|
commitdiff
|
tree
2016-11-15
rsandifo
Fix ins
t
ances of gen_rtx_REG (VOI
D
mode,
.
.
.
)
commit
|
commitdiff
|
tree
2016-11-15
rsandifo
Use
MEM_
S
IZE rather than GET_MO
D
E_SIZ
E
in dce
.
c
commit
|
commitdiff
|
tree
2016-11-15
rsandifo
Use simp
l
ify_gen_binary in canon
_
rtx
commit
|
commitdiff
|
tree
2016-11-15
rs
a
ndifo
Add a l
o
ad_e
x
tend_op wrapper
commit
|
commitdiff
|
tree
2016-11-15
rsandifo
Fix simplify_shi
f
t_co
n
st_1 handling of
vector shi
f
t
s
commit
|
commitdiff
|
tree
2016-11-15
rsandifo
Move misplaced
a
ssignmen
t
in num_sign
_
b
i
t
_
copies1
commit
|
commitdiff
|
tree
2016-11-15
rsandifo
Fix scri
p
t
o in ChangeLog
commit
|
commitdiff
|
tree
2016-11-15
r
s
a
ndifo
Fix
a GET
_
M
O
D
E_CLASS
t
ypo
in mem_
l
oc
_
descriptor
commit
|
commitdiff
|
tree
2016-07-06
rsand
i
f
o
[7/7]
Add negative and zero
strides to vect_memory_access_type
commit
|
commitdiff
|
tree
2016-07-06
rsandifo
[6/7] Explicitly c
l
assi
f
y vector loads and stores
commit
|
commitdiff
|
tree
2016-07-06
rsandif
o
[
5/7] Move the fix
f
or
P
R65
5
18
commit
|
commitdiff
|
tree
2016-07-06
rsandifo
[
4
/
7
]
Add
a gather
_
scatt
e
r_info str
u
cture
commit
|
commitdiff
|
tree
2016-07-06
rsand
i
f
o
[3/7] Fix load
/
s
tore costs for stride
d
groups
commit
|
commitdiff
|
tree
2016-07-06
r
s
an
d
ifo
[2/7] Clean up vectorizer
l
oad/store cost
s
commit
|
commitdiff
|
tree
2016-07-06
rsa
n
difo
[1
/
7] Remov
e
u
nnecessary peeling for gaps c
h
eck
commit
|
commitdiff
|
tree
2016-06-08
r
s
a
n
difo
Rem
o
ve word_
m
ode hack
f
or split bi
t
f
ields
commit
|
commitdiff
|
tree
2016-05-26
r
s
andifo
Fix ivopts
e
stima
t
es
fo
r
internal
f
unctions
commit
|
commitdiff
|
tree
2016-05-24
rs
a
n
d
ifo
Clean u
p
PURE_SLP_
S
TMT handli
n
g
commit
|
commitdiff
|
tree
2016-05-24
rsandifo
Avoid
u
nnec
e
ssary p
e
eling for gaps with LD3
commit
|
commitdiff
|
tree
2016-05-24
rsan
d
i
fo
Fix GROUP_
G
AP for single-elemen
t
i
n
terl
e
avin
g
commit
|
commitdiff
|
tree
2016-05-18
rsandifo
To: g
c
c
-
pa
t
che
s
@gcc
.
gn
u
.
org
commit
|
commitdiff
|
tree
next